Description Dan Winship 2008-03-27 15:18:24 UTC
Open the clock pop-up, click "Edit" to edit the locations. Add a new location.
The location shows up immediately in the panel pop-up/map, but it doesn't show
up in the table in the Clock Preferences window. Closing and reopening the
preferences doesn't help. You need to log out and back in to get it to show the
new location there.

Comment 1 Matthias Clasen 2008-03-28 16:38:40 UTC
This was a recent regression. Fixed in both upstream and rawhide.
